MD Turbines, Inc. is seeking a detail-oriented and proactive Purchasing Coordinator to support the procurement of office materials, warehouse supplies, and operational resources. This position is responsible for ensuring departments have the materials and supplies needed to maintain efficient daily operations while managing vendor relationships and purchase records.
The ideal candidate is organized, resourceful, and capable of managing multiple purchasing requests in a fast-paced aviation environment.
Responsibilities
- Purchase office supplies, warehouse materials, and operational equipment as needed
- Obtain pricing, quotes, and availability information from vendors and suppliers
- Create and process purchase orders accurately and efficiently
- Monitor inventory levels and coordinate replenishment of stock items
- Track orders and ensure timely delivery of purchased materials
- Maintain accurate purchasing records, invoices, and vendor documentation
- Communicate with vendors regarding pricing, lead times, and order status
- Assist with vendor selection and supplier relationship management
- Coordinate with department managers to identify purchasing needs and priorities
- Support costsaving initiatives and purchasing process improvements
- Perform additional administrative and procurementrelated duties as assigned

About MD Turbines Inc
Founded in 2011 by Manuel De Jesus, MD Turbines began in a 4,000 sq. ft. leased space with just a few employees and a vision to deliver excellence in turbine engine disassembly and aircraft part logistics. Over the years, we’ve grown into a team of over 125 professionals operating from a 125,000 sq. ft. headquarters and an additional 140,000 sq. ft. of storage space. Our services include engine teardown, FAA 145-certified repairs, and long-haul logistics, supported by advanced inspection technologies. With a strong culture focused on quality, training, and customer satisfaction, we continue to lead in innovation and reliability.
